    About Gtn Ltd

    Gtn Ltd is a marketing services company. The company operates broadcast media advertising platforms that supply traffic information reports to radio and/or television stations. The company offers advertising spots on television and radio networks, adjacent to information reports that listeners are typically engaged with traffic and news, as this content is of use to the consumer. Its advertising platform enables advertisers to reach audiences in Australia, Canada, the UnitedKingdom, and Brazil.

    Directors & Management Data provided by Morningstar.

    Data provided by Morningstar.
    Name Title Start Date Profile
    Mr David John Ryan Non-Executive Director Apr 2016
    Mr Ryan has over 40 years of experience in commercial banking, investment banking and operational business management. David is also currently Chairman of Visit Sunshine Coast Limited (formerly Sunshine Coast Destination Limited), a director of First American Title Insurance Company of Australia Pty Ltd, a director of First Mortgage Services Pty Ltd, a director of Sunshine Coast Airport Pty Limited and Board member of the Sunshine Coast Events Board. David has previously held positions as a non-executive director of GetSwift Limited from April 2018 to April 2019, a non-executive director of Lendlease Corporation Limited from December 2004 until his retirement in November 2017, non-executive director of Aston Resources from 2011 until its merger with Whitehaven Coal and as non-executive chairman of Transurban Holdings (appointed director in 2003, chairman in 2007, and retired in 2010). He is Chairman of Risk Committee.
    Mr Robert (Rob) Loewenthal Non-Executive Director Apr 2016
    Mr Loewenthal has over 10 years of experience in the radio industry. He currently operates a private corporate advisory and consulting business, Free Trade Hall, and is the founder of the Whooshkaa Podcasting Platform. Robert formerly held the role of Managing Director of Macquarie Radio Network, where he had previously acted as Chief Operating Officer and company secretary. He is Member of Risk Committee.
    Mr Peter Charles Tonagh Non-Executive DirectorNon-Executive Chairman Sep 2020
    Mr Tonagh has a background as a C-suite executive in Australian media companies, including as CEO of Foxtel and News Corp Australia, interim-CEO of REA Group and Chairman of MCN. Peter was formerly a partner at The Boston Consulting Group where he led the Asia Pacific Organisation Practice and worked across media, consumer and financial services businesses. Peter is currently a member of the board of Australian Broadcasting Corporation (ABC) and previously was the independent director of Village Roadshow and chairman of Quantium.
    Ms Corinna Keller Non-Executive Director Mar 2019
    Ms Keller is Vice President of Advertising Sales for the Americas for CNN International Commercial (a WarnerMedia company), which she joined in 2016. Corinna oversees the pan-regional ad sales business for CNN International, CNN en Espanol, CNN.com/international and CNNEspanol.com for Latin America and clients based in the U.S. and Canada who want to target international viewers. From 1999 to 2015, Corinna was with Viacom in various roles, her last as Vice President, International Marketing Partnerships and Pan-regional Ad Sales, running the pan-regional advertising business for Nickelodeon, MTV, Comedy Central, Paramount Channel and VH1, and digital portfolio. She held a number of senior positions with Viacom in both the U.S. and Mexico and managed client relationships with Fortune 500 companies across the U.S., Latin America, Europe and Asia. Prior to Viacom, Corinna was in the pay television industry at Turner Broadcasting, where she assisted in distribution for the newly launched CNN en Espanol. She is Member of Risk Committee.
    Ms Alexi Baker Non-Executive Director Jun 2022
    Ms Baker is Chief Customer and Digital Officer of National Rugby League, after being appointed in May 2021. Prior to this, she spent nine years across various roles with Nine Entertainment Co including Managing Director Commercial and Director of Strategy and M&A. Prior to this she worked in investment banking at Deutsche Bank and Credit Suisse. She is an experienced executive and director with expertise across media, digital, transformation, strategy and large transactions. At National Rugby League she is responsible for all consumer revenue streams, digital, marketing and customer experience.
